India are set to tackle New Zealand within the first semi-final of the ICC Cricket World Cup 2023 in a rerun of the identical fixture from the earlier version of the event.
Workforce India on Wednesday have the prospect to rewrite the heartbreaking reminiscences of the 2019 Cricket World Cup the place they had been routed by the Black Caps within the semi-final in Manchester.
This time India have dominated the group stage as the one unbeaten facet within the event. New Zealand, then again, made it by way of into the final 4 with 5 wins from 9 matches.
The group stage assembly between the 2 groups got here on 22 October, with India profitable by 4 wickets.
Wankhede Stadium pitch report
Wednesday’s semi-final will start at 2pm native time and is being performed on the iconic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ai.
The toss can be key, as fielding first is more likely to be a bonus. Sixty per cent of the matches on the pitch on this event have been received by groups which have batted second.
The purple soil on the Wankhede Stadium is understood to generate formidable bounce and dew can later develop into a significant component. Because of this captains are likely to choose to chase reasonably than bat first.
The pitch at Wankhede is nonetheless batter-friendly, and has helped groups put up some large totals within the World Cup to this point.
Mumbai climate report
The climate will principally be sunny through the 2023 World Cup semi-final, in response to AccuWeather.
There’s only a one per cent likelihood of precipitation, so there isn’t any danger of rain enjoying spoilsport through the first semi-final. Humidity is anticipated to be at 30 per cent and temperatures are anticipated to fluctuate between 36C and 25C at night time.
India batter Virat Kohli is the present main run-scorer within the World Cup. He has 594 runs in 9 matches at a mean of 99.
New Zealand’s Rachin Ravindra is third on the runs desk. He has scored 565 runs at a mean of 70.62.
Quick bowler Jasprit Bumrah has picked up 17 wickets – greater than another Indian bowler and yet another than his teammate Ravindra Jadeja.
Left-arm spinner Mitchell Santner has been the most effective bowler for the Kiwis this event, with 16 wickets in 9 video games.
